⚡ Why TPO Roofing Is the Smart Choice for Central Florida Businesses
TPO — short for Thermoplastic Polyolefin — is a single-ply rubber membrane roofing system designed for flat and low-slope roofs. It’s built to withstand the Florida heat, resist UV damage, and reflect sunlight to help reduce cooling costs.
Property owners in Orlando, Winter Park, Kissimmee, and throughout Central Florida choose TPO roofing because it provides:
Excellent energy efficiency – Reflective white surface reduces heat absorption and lowers energy bills.
Durable heat-welded seams – Creates a watertight bond stronger than glue or tape.
Fast installation – Perfect for business owners who need minimal downtime.
Easy maintenance – A TPO roof is simple to clean and inspect, saving time and long-term costs.
🧱 Longevity and Reliability of TPO Roof Systems
A properly installed TPO roof can last 20 years or more with regular maintenance. The system consists of a single rubber membrane layer, making it lightweight yet strong enough to protect against rain, sun, and chemical exposure.
Because it’s a single-ply membrane, TPO is ideal for buildings with open roof exposure — such as warehouses, shopping centers, and other commercial spaces without heavy tree coverage. However, in areas with extensive trees and falling branches, a two-ply modified bitumen system may be a better option for impact resistance.
🔨 Roof Replacement and Roof-Over Options
One of the key advantages of TPO roofing is flexibility. Not only can a TPO system replace an existing flat roof, but it can also be installed over an existing TPO roof — known as a TPO roof-over.
This option saves labor costs, debris removal fees, and project downtime, while still qualifying for top-tier manufacturer warranties. Standing Seam vs. 5V Crimp — Choosing the Right Metal Roof
For homeowners in Orlando, Winter Park, Longwood, and Central Florida, we recommend two main residential styles: Standing Seam and 5V Crimp.
Standing Seam Metal Roofing is the premium option, featuring hidden fasteners and sleek modern lines. Because the screws are concealed beneath the seams, there’s no risk of water intrusion through fastener holes—making this system one of the most waterproof and low-maintenance roofing solutions available. Standing seam metal can be installed on any roof with a pitch above ¼″ and is perfect for modern custom homes throughout College Park, Winter Park, and Maitland. These roofs require skilled roofing contractors to hand-craft and install each panel, ensuring unmatched quality and longevity.
If your project requires a more budget-friendly roof replacement, 5V Crimp Metal Roofing is a beautiful and cost-effective alternative. It uses exposed fasteners with waterproof gaskets to prevent leaks and can be installed on roofs with a minimum 3:12 pitch. This design is ideal for barns, roof-overs, and farmhouse-style homes in College Park, Winter Park, Osteen, and Mims. While more affordable, it still delivers excellent protection, energy efficiency, and professional craftsmanship.
Metal Roofing Gauges & Finishes
Both metal roof styles come in 26-gauge or 24-gauge panels, and you can choose among three main finishes:
Kynar Painted (premium) – longest lifespan and best color retention, backed by 40-year warranties.
SMP Painted (mid-range) – affordable and durable, available in many color options.
Raw Galvalume (budget-friendly) – silver finish with a 25-year rust warranty and excellent solar reflectivity for improved home efficiency.
Each option can complement your home’s style while providing long-term weather protection and energy savings—perfect for Central Florida roofing needs.
Recommended Underlayment for Metal Roofs
For every metal roof installation, we recommend Polyglass Polystick TU MTS, a high-temperature, fully-adhered peel-and-stick underlayment. This layer provides a watertight seal beneath your roof, offering additional protection during Florida’s severe storms.

At Southern Traditions Roofing, we’ve seen that with a high-quality, professionally installed asphalt shingle roof, homeowners in Orlando, Winter Park, Longwood, and surrounding communities can realistically expect 15–20 years of performance without major issues. Of course, proper maintenance is key — keeping gutters clear, cleaning valleys, and soft-washing your roof every 5–7 years will help extend its life.
We recommend shingles rated for 130+ mph wind resistance, which are ideal for Central Florida’s weather. Some of the most trusted roofing brands we work with include GAF Timberline HDZ, CertainTeed Landmark, Tamko Titan XT, and Owens Corning Duration. While we routinely install GAF shingles (we’re a GAF-Certified Installer, which allows us to offer enhanced wind-speed warranties), all of these premium options deliver quality, durability, and curb appeal that homeowners can trust.
One of the most common questions we get is whether to choose a full peel-and-stick underlayment or synthetic felt. Both are excellent options. We often recommend peel-and-stick because it creates a fully sealed roof deck. If a severe storm removes your shingles, this layer protects against interior leaks and water damage while you wait for your roofing contractor to replace the shingles — no emergency tarp or drywall repairs needed. Many home insurance providers even offer premium discounts for this upgrade.
That said, we know every homeowner has a unique budget. Synthetic felt underlayment is still a great, cost-effective roofing solution that meets Florida Building Code standards and allows the roof to breathe. Even with that choice, we install peel-and-stick material in key areas — valleys, flashing, and high-flow water zones — to ensure extra protection. On an average-sized roof in the Orlando/Central Florida area (about 30 squares), the price difference for full peel-and-stick is typically around $1,000.

Clay and concrete tile roofs are among the most aesthetically pleasing and durable roofing options you’ll find in the Orlando and Central Florida area. Homeowners frequently ask us about their lifespan, brand recommendations, and the best materials to pair with tile roofs for long-term performance.
Tile Roof Popularity in Central Florida
We typically see a large number of tile roofs in the outer suburbs of Orlando, especially in Windermere, Longwood, Lake Mary, and Lake Nona. Tile roofing became especially popular during the 1990s and early 2000s, when these neighborhoods were rapidly developing. Even today, these roofs continue to stand out for their timeless Mediterranean and Spanish-inspired design.
Lifespan and Underlayment Upgrades
Unlike asphalt shingles, which generally last 15–20 years, clay and concrete tile roofs often last 25–30 years or more when properly maintained. Many of the tile roofs we replace today are 25–30 years old and still performing well—despite having only a traditional saturated asphalt felt underlayment.
Modern installations are even more durable thanks to fully self-adhered high-temperature underlayments such as:
Polyglass Polystick TU PLUS (manufactured here in Florida)
Owens Corning Titanium PSU 30
CMI PS SecureGrip HT
These premium products seal the roof decking completely, improving both longevity and moisture protection in Florida’s hot, humid climate.
Recommended Tile Brands
Our favorite concrete tile brands to work with are Eagle Roofing Products and Westlake Royal Roofing. Both manufacturers offer exceptional durability, color variety, and profiles to match any homeowner’s style.
For clay tile roofs, we often recommend Santa Fe and Verea—two overseas brands that excel at delivering an authentic Tuscan, Spanish, or Mediterranean aesthetic that perfectly complements many homes across Central Florida.
Cost vs. Curb Appeal
Tile roofing does come with a premium price tag—typically 2.5x to 3x the cost of a standard asphalt shingle roof. However, the trade-off is unmatched beauty, longevity, and home value.
